Explorer setup is great. actually fits the 351 better then the 302, more frame clearance. But you do need to remember to change the balance of the damper as the late 5.0 is different then the 351.

Electric fuel pump is your only option. Carter P4070 is a well known great choice.

As for a gear drive. Those are not commonly used. But a standard double roller timing chaind does fit just fine under the Explorer cover. I can't see any reason a standard gear drive would be a problem. You will just have to test fit it to really know.

I am running a 351w, C4 combo with the 2 speed taurus fan with no issues.. Volvo 2 speed fans are the same fan but are a little narrower.
